Green Procurement I+II
The production, delivery, use and disposal of the numerous products used in healthcare have significant impacts on the environment. Buying environmentally preferable and safe products and services can drastically improve the environmental performance of healthcare facilities.

Learn about the experiences with green procurement in Austria, Denmark, Germany and Sweden.
